Ryanair extends maintenance agreement with Joramco to 10 maintenance lines

Ryanair announced an extension to its maintenance agreement with Joramco, the MRO provider based in Jordan, which will see the airline undertake 10 lines of heavy maintenance for the next 10 years at their MRO facility in Amman, Jordan. Beond Airlines receives second aircraft to support expansion of premium leisure air travel

Beond announced lease and receipt of a new aircraft to serve new customers desiring a unique travel experience to the Maldives. The Airbus A321 aircraft is presently undergoing a reconfiguration to seat 68 discerning customers in premium, all-lay flat seating. RECARO Aircraft Seating selected by Air India as premium economy and economy seating partner for widebody aircraft

RECARO Aircraft Seating was selected by Air India as the premium economy and economy seating partner for their widebody aircraft. Airlines and airports increase IT spend to improve the passenger journey and meet sustainability goals

SITA 2023 Air Transport IT Insights report finds that both airports and airlines saw IT spend increase year on year into 2023, reaching an estimated 10.8 billion USD and 34.5 billion USD respectively, with over two-thirds of airport and airline CIOs expecting continued growth into 2024. 21st group with 16 students begin studies at airBaltic Pilot Academy

On February 5, 2024, the 21st group of 16 students began their professional pilot studies at the airBaltic Pilot Academy. Their aim is to receive a commercial pilot license upon completion of the full-time airline transport pilot program. The 21st group of cadets represents countries such as Finland, France, Germany, Italy, Latvia, Lithuania, and the Netherlands. CAE and Global Crossing Airlines sign exclusive A320 pilot training agreement

CAE has signed a long-term exclusive pilot training agreement with Global Crossing Airlines to deploy and operate an Airbus A320 family full-flight simulator in Miami, Florida. The FFS is scheduled to be ready for training in the first quarter of 2024 to support GlobalX’s ongoing growth and the expansion of its Airbus A321 freighter fleet. Traffic from Munich Airport to Asia surpasses pre-pandemic level

The high demand for air travel is reflected in the increasing number of aircraft movements at Munich Airport. For example, the airport will see record numbers of services to Asia in the 2024 summer flight schedule starting on March 31: A total of nine airlines are currently planning 107 weekly flights to 14 destinations in ten countries in East and South Asia.
